Sheebah and Irene Ntale wish Eddy Kenzo good luck ahead of today’s concert [Photo]

BigEyeUg3By BigEyeUg3August 14, 2015
Share
Facebook Twitter Telegram WhatsApp

By Seguya Musa 

Sexy divas Irene Ntale and Sheebah Karungi ran into Eddy Kenzo yesterday and wished him luck ahead of his Mbilo Mbilo concert which is due to take place today (14th august) at hotel Africana, People’s space.

The “Otubatisa” singers couldn’t resist taking photos with the BET winner which they later shared on social media captioned: “And the #BET winner is Eddy Kenzo Go support our boy tomorrow..in #MBILO #MBILO Concert @Africana Will be in Masaka entertaining my Sheebaholics there but Good luck Boy”.
